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
159632835 13574906 0509031 38412725570
1271689482 0646629212 1333
1271689482 0646629212 1333
680050 1028973 967741544
All about undefined
Interested in learning more?
1271689482 0646629212 1333
680050 1028973 967741544
See more
48635079963 348415952 188
906 13556 0259194
See more
71072548625 4117
44906862952 7422 814 87
See more